[Bug 160705] Can't write korean

2007-11-07 Thread zelon
Public bug reported:

 I installed ubuntu 7.10 with Korean language setting.

 But, after installation, I can't write korean.

 Instead of Korean, I can write a word with Amharic. Amharic is not
Korean.

 So I install scim-hangul. After installation scim-hangul, I can write
Korean.

[Bug 132884] Can't compress to .7z with a space in there name

2007-08-16 Thread zelon
Public bug reported:

Binary package hint: p7zip

1. in /home/zelon/vmwareImages/Using WinXP in nautilus
2. select any files
3. mouse right button - make archive...
4. select 7z
5. make

result:

7-Zip (A) 4.43 beta  Copyright (c) 1999-2006 Igor Pavlov  2006-09-15
p7zip Version 4.43 (locale=ko_KR.UTF-8,Utf16=on,HugeFiles=on,2 CPUs)


Error:
Incorrect command line
